2 publicationsSchiff Bases of Benzimidazole Analogues: Synthesis, Characterization and Biological Activity
Benzimidazole derivatives play an important role in medicinal field with many biological and pharmacological activities related to it. Extensive biochemical and pharmacological studies have confirmed that the potency of these clinically useful drugs in treatment of microbial infections is encouraging and inspiring for further development of some more potent and significant compounds. A series of benzopyrone substituted benzimidazole derivatives were synthesized by reacting benzopyrone-3-carboxylic acid with o-phenylene diamine. The analogues were synthesized in a good yield. The structural characterizations for derivatives were carried out by IR, 1HNMR and Mass spectral studies. The compounds were subjected for antibacterial screening, among them 4c and 4i showed appreciable activity against all the strains. It can be concluded from the antibacterial study that the derivatives may be proved useful for future development.
Synthesis and Antibacterial Study of Some New Benzimidazole Substituted Quinoline Derivatives
As many scientific and technical observations are pouring informations about the activity and effectiveness of synthetic and semi synthetic derivatives related to quinolines and benzimidazoles it was concern to explore this two leads in a single molecular entity. The present study embodied the synthesis and evaluation of antibacterial activity of a series of benzimidazole substituted quinoline derivatives condensed with different amines. The derivatives were synthesized in moderate to good yields. The characterizations for the synthesized derivatives were done by IR, 1H NMR and Mass spectral analysis. The compounds were then subjected for antibacterial screening, among them 4c and 4d showed appreciable activity against all the strains used. In the light of the results obtained from antibacterial studies, these derivatives can be further thoroughly investigated for future prospect.

1 publicationSynthesis of Some γ-Benzopyrone Derivatives as Analgesic Agents
Considering the potential to be a lead molecule and having a wide variety of pharmacological activities like anti-inflammatory, anticancer, antihepatotoxic, antibacterial, antiviral etc., a series of bioactive γ-benzopyrone compounds were synthesized and analgesic activity was evaluated. The synthesized compounds were characterized by IR, 1H NMR and Mass spectral studies. Some of the compounds synthesized i.e. 4c, 4d, 4g and 4h showed appreciable analgesic activity.
